I figured the way things are going and considering the rather heated email I've been sending that discretion was the better part of valor right now so when I placed the order I said, "our customers are DEMANDING that we make some khukuris like our kamis would make them for use in the village."

Briefly, I asked for typical village cosmetics both blade and handle, various sizes, that each kami make and mark (they may omit the HI mark -- I left this optional to see what they would do) a half dozen khukuris ranging from 14 to about 24 inches. Village sarki scabbard. I think we have seven master kamis right now so this should give us a start of about 40 khukuris.
